The second photo is, several of us (Rabe Anton, G Morrison and Jim Perry) think, 2208 damaged as follows:
Fw 190A-2, WNr 2208, flown and crashed by Oblt. Herbert Huppertz, of 10/JG 5. He was an RKT and scored 70 abschusse. This happened on 15-Sept-42. He was Staffelkapitain and was injured in the crash. This happened near Mogensback, Denmark. The "o" has a slash which I cannot duplicate. It is listed as a 30% damaged. The aircraft displays some A-4 characteristics such as the antenna lead. JG 5 received many A-2 and A-3 "recycled" machines from JGs 2 and 26 during this time. A dead giveaway for JG 5 is the large KZ. 2208 had two more "lives" within the Erg. Staffel of SKG 10 in 1943 before being destroyed in the third crash on 27-Jun-43. |
